Differences between flour and okara
- Flour is higher in vitamin B1, selenium, iron, folate, vitamin B2, vitamin B3, manganese, vitamin B5, and phosphorus; however, okara is richer in calcium.
- Flour's daily need coverage for vitamin B1 is 64% higher.
- Flour has 59 times more vitamin B3 than okara. While flour has 5.904mg of vitamin B3, okara has only 0.1mg.
The food types used in this comparison are Wheat flour, white, all-purpose, enriched, bleached and Okara.
